Web30 jan. 2024 · Apply Deck Stain Evenly. Work In Small Areas. When applying deck stain, it is best to work in small areas. A great method is to stain only one or two boards at a time. Start with one board and coat it as far as it spans across the deck before jumping back and starting on the next one. This helps eliminate lap marks and provides a much evener coat. But make sure you wear a slipper since the cold air will make the water super cold. … Web9 nov. 2024 · For clear sealer, the deck surface and air temperature must be above 50 degrees Fahrenheit during application and drying time. For deck stain, the deck surface and air temperature should be between 50 and 95 Fahrenheit for application and drying. The forecast should indicate no rain for at least 24 hours after application. Web29 nov. 2005 · Apply stain when the weather is agreeable. The best temperature is about 70° F. 50-90° F is the optimum working range. Wait for a day with low humidity and … Web10 mrt. 2024 · The ideal temperature for a wood stain ranges between 50 and 90 degrees Fahrenheit. If the temperature is too high, the surface might dry too fast, not allowing the stain to set into the wood pores ad color it appropriately. If the mercury dips too low, the stain will struggle to dry.

Web11 mrt. 2024 · While latex or water-based stain will be dry in about 4 to 6 hours, your freshly stained deck needs at least 24-48 hours before it rains. Oil-based stains that usually dry in about 12 to 24 hours will require a minimum of 48 hours before the rain. Web8 feb. 2024 · Is It Ok To Paint in Cold Weather. Before applying a sealer, clean the deck thoroughly with a scrub brush and a cleaner made for decks. Avoid cleaners that contain chlorine bleach, which can damage wood fibers. Oxygenated bleach cleaners usually work better. If you choose to clean the deck with a power washer, do so carefully.
